by Richie Unterberger
Versatile singer Marie Knight recorded gospel with The Millionaires, also cutting some nice pop-soul in the early '60s, and some jump-blues and doo wop-flavored R&B. If she's known to rock fans at all, it's because Manfred Mann covered her 1961 single "Come Tomorrow" for a big UK, and small US, hit in 1965. ~ Richie Unterberger, All Music Guide
